Class DefaultCapabilityService
java.lang.Object
org.praxisplatform.uischema.capability.DefaultCapabilityService
- All Implemented Interfaces:
CapabilityService
Monta snapshots unificados de capabilities sobre os eixos canonicamente publicados.
-
Constructor Summary
ConstructorsConstructorDescriptionDefaultCapabilityService(CanonicalCapabilityResolver canonicalCapabilityResolver, SurfaceCatalogService surfaceCatalogService, ActionCatalogService actionCatalogService, OpenApiDocumentService openApiDocumentService) -
Method Summary
Modifier and TypeMethodDescriptioncollectionCapabilities(String resourceKey, String resourcePath) itemCapabilities(String resourceKey, String resourcePath, Object resourceId)
-
Constructor Details
-
DefaultCapabilityService
public DefaultCapabilityService(CanonicalCapabilityResolver canonicalCapabilityResolver, SurfaceCatalogService surfaceCatalogService, ActionCatalogService actionCatalogService, OpenApiDocumentService openApiDocumentService)
-
-
Method Details
-
collectionCapabilities
- Specified by:
collectionCapabilitiesin interfaceCapabilityService
-
itemCapabilities
public CapabilitySnapshot itemCapabilities(String resourceKey, String resourcePath, Object resourceId) - Specified by:
itemCapabilitiesin interfaceCapabilityService
-